Cross by default runs tracks at normal speed.
Pitch slider adjusts speed. Pitch range setting sets range for slider.
Other influence is sync option. To sync to Master deck.

Try controlling from gui first to exclude MIDI mapping issues.

Don't understand how you on one side mention it to run fast, but you don't have sound.

If you register you can download the latest version of Cross from the downloads section. I don't expect it to resolve either of the issues mentioned, but always best to have the latest.

Please post a screen capture of your audio settings in preferences. It should be the local driver. If available the ASIO version of it.
Output 1 should be selected.
Mode best be simple stereo.
Use default buffer size. Can be tuned later.
